Part installation, part musical performance, the project is a meditation on the air required to play an instrument. “Performing an original composition by Veronika Krausas, De Aere (concerning the air), the musicians clean the air that produces the music, their roving forms evocative of the exchange of air between plants and human inhabitants,” the statement continues. Aiming to ensure the continued legacy of musicians as our cities’ atmospheres grow more polluted, the intimate piece encouraged viewers to reflect upon complex notions such as the relationships between purity and pollution, and between body and nature, while bringing awareness to shared concerns about the future.
